          Pretty much, yeah. The driver in FreeBSD 11.3 / pfSense 2.4.5 cannot return a link speed of 2.5G or 5G but it seemingly can show unknown.
          The most recent drivers will be in FreeBSD 12 or those Intel offers for download.

          Try a pfSense 2.5 snapshot, currenntly based on 12-rel. Or a newer FreeBSD image.

                        Just another data point:

                        pfsense 2.5.1-RELEASE (amd64)

                        Intel X550-T2 connected to the 2.5Gb port on an Arris Surfboard S33 Cable Modem support page:

                        Standard Specification Compliant	DOCSIS 3.1
                        Hardware Version	                V1.0
                        Software Version	                TB01.01.001.14_102120_192.S3
                        
                        Energy Efficient Ethernet               Enabled
                        

                        Connected with a 10m Cat8 Cable.

                        ifconfig -m ix1 reports:

                        media: Ethernet autoselect (Unknown <rxpause,txpause>)
                        	status: active
                        	supported media:
                        		media autoselect
                        		media 100baseTX
                        		media 1000baseT
                        		media 10Gbase-T
                        

                        From the transfer speeds it definitely seems to be connected at greater than 1Gb and seems to be 2.5Gb from what I can tell. Obviously it's not paused.

                        WAN is on ix1, LAN is on igb1, ix0, igb0, and re0 (motherboard) are not currently connected. Eventually ix0 will connected to a 10GBASE-T SFP+ transceiver on a 10G switch as soon as I get around to installing the switch with another 10G Cat8.

                        So the hardware still seems happy to auto-negotiate to 2500Mbps, even though the FreeBSD ix driver can't report it. ¯_(ツ)_/¯ Annoying, but usable. Where do I sign the "Dear Intel" "metoo" petition? ;-)

                          The presence of <rxpause,txpause> there indicates that flow control is active on that link. Not that it's actually paused at that moment.

                                2.5/5G added to the kernel's ixgbe driver with this commit: https://cgit.freebsd.org/src/commit/sys/dev/ixgbe/ixgbe.h?id=d381c807510de2ebb453a563540bd17e344a2aab

                                    It's only in 13-stable right now so at the very least it would need either to brought into 12 stable or pfSense moved to 13 stable (or newer).
